| Course Description |
The purpose of this course is to provide a basic introduction to accounting, including the foundations of accounting concepts, the underlying mechanics, and the overall perspective required to become intelligent users of accounting information. The course will focus on the main financial statements, the nature of accrual measurement, and the information perspective. In addition, we will explore some accounting methods in detail, such as revenue recognition, assets, liabilities, and equity. The overarching perspective is that accounting reports provide information that is useful for a variety of purposes. In the course, I will also provide insights into how the financial markets use accounting information to evaluate executives, predict future stock returns, assess firms’ riskiness, and allocate society’s resources to their most productive uses.
